Income/Financial Stability
Our Goal
Help individuals and families meet basic needs and achieve financial independence.
Our Strategies
Basic Needs: Support efforts that provide individuals and families with basic needs such as food, housing, emergency shelter, transportation, access to healthcare, and access to quality affordable childcare.
Financial Counseling: Support efforts that educate and counsel individuals and families to improve their financial stability.
Employment Counseling and Job Training: Support efforts to assist the unemployed and underemployed to identify and maximize their employment and career potential.
